Output 1366e25ce659e1b3d334cdaf7aeb5edb6cf05f864f3935e683d05e4e04d47c52:0

value
755564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5242563b690e024aed1f6829683db3bb22ea64 OP_EQUAL
address
3K3LrTQ8BTedE6NNx8EgSjNQWMEaSNds9y
transaction
1366e25ce659e1b3d334cdaf7aeb5edb6cf05f864f3935e683d05e4e04d47c52
spent
true